Roman goes solo with Catholic priest, Father Chris Townsend. Roman and Chris discuss the purpose of religion in a pluralistic, liberal democracy. Chris argues that religion gives meaning to people and that the church should create dialogue to heal existential and psychological wounds. Roman investigates whether religion really does give people meaning, and what the future of religion might be. The conversation ends with a discussion around the repercussions the sex scandals have had on the church.




(Visited 15 times, 1 visits today)

The Renegade Report – The Purpose of Religion